コーディングもするデザイナーが知っておきたい SVG 最適化(svgo v3 対応)
Docker Desktop と SVGO プラグインでしている SVG 最適化について、覚書を残しておきます。 設定ファイル(imagemin.js) const keepfolder = req…
View Article(Node.js) @mapbox/tilebeltモジュールを理解する
はじめに node.jsのコードの中で@mapbox/tilebeltモジュールを使用する機会があったので、どのようなモジュールであるのか簡単にまとめたいと思います。 @mapbox/tilebel…
View ArticleNestJSでCloud Runのコンテナ自URLを正しく取得する方法
はじめに NestJS を使って Cloud Run 上にデプロイされたアプリケーション内で、自サービスの URL を取得する際に、req.protocol が http になってしまうことがありま…
View ArticleLambdaからFargateへの切り替える際にNode.jsアプリのタスクスペックをどう決めたか?
最近、LambdaからFargateに移行して、Node.js(NestJS)アプリの動作を最適化するためにタスクスペック(CPUやメモリの割り当て)についていろいろ試行錯誤しました。この経験を踏ま…
View ArticleNode.jsのunzipperで解凍したらファイルが少なかった件
初めてunzipperを使いました unzipperの最も基本的な使い方ですが、初歩の初歩で躓いてしまいました 具体的にはZIPを解凍したら解凍先のディレクトリにあるはずのファイルがなかったという感…
View Articlepnpmの "not found: node" エラーを解決する方法
はじめに pnpmを使用してプロジェクトの依存関係をインストールしようとした際に、以下のようなエラーに遭遇することがあります: ENOENT not found: node pnpm: not fo…
View Articleインポート機能、エクスポート機能APIの作り方(Node.js、Springboot)
今回はインポート機能、エクスポート機能APIの作り方を記事にしました。 インポート機能とエクスポート機能を実装するAPIの作り方をステップバイステップで説明します。一般的には、CSVやExcel形式…
View ArticleNestJSのルーティングでハマらないために:静的パスと動的パスの順序に気をつけよう
はじめに NestJS(express.js)のルーティングにおいて、静的パスと動的パスの定義順序がアプリケーションの動作に重大な影響を与えることがあります。この順序を理解して正しく設定することで、…
View ArticleReact_Webアプリケーション開発入門① ~React開発環境構築〜
1. 本ページについて Reactの導入および環境構築の手順書を示す。 また、基礎理解と動作確認を兼ねた簡単なHello World表示をゴールとする。 2. 前提 以下を満たしているとなお良いです。 ・HTML/CSSの基本は理解している…
View ArticleAlmaLinux+Reactの環境構築
AlmaLinux+Reactの環境構築 1. 事前準備 2. 投稿主の実装環境 3. 各ソフトウェア・ツールの説明(Node.js,npm,nvm,CreateReactApp,React) 4.…
View ArticleReact_Webアプリケーション開発入門② 〜画面遷移を学ぶ〜
本ページについて 本ページではReactとnode.jsを用いた超簡潔な勤怠登録アプリケーションを開発します。 環境構築および動作確認は完了しているものとします。環境構築から始める人は下記記事を参照…
View ArticleGitHub Actionsでスケジュールされたバッチ処理の自動実行
毎朝6時にsupabaseのテーブルを自動でリセットしたい!ということで ①毎朝6時にトリガーされる.ymlで ②supabaseの指定したテーブルを全部削除する.tsを実行することにしました na…
View ArticleStorybookのストーリー数の数え方
背景 運用中のStorybookのストーリー数が知りたかった。 でもGoogleで検索したりChatGPTに聞いたりしても、知る方法を見つけられなかった。 (ChatGPTは近いことを教えてくれまし…
View Articleテスト環境を外部公開してみた(AlmaLinux+ngrok+react)
Nginxの導入方法 1. 事前準備 2. 投稿主の実装環境 3. ngrokとは 4. 環境構築 5. nginx便利コマンド 1. 事前準備 ・今回はngrokがメインのため、Reactの構築は…
View Article(Node.js) @mapbox/geojson-areaモジュールを理解する
はじめに node.jsのコードの中で@mapbox/geojson-areaモジュールを使用する機会があったので、どのようなモジュールであるのか簡単にまとめたいと思います。 @mapbox/geo…
View Article休憩時間をライフゲームに委ねるアプリをつくってみた
こんなものをつくります デスクトップで動く休憩時間管理アプリです。 開始してから黒いセルがなくなるまで休憩できる!というルールになっています。 休憩中 休憩終了 これは**Game of Life…
View Articleエージェンシーのウェブサイトを作成する方法
My website: https://alleekhan.exblog.jp エージェンシーのウェブサイトを作成する方法 エージェンシーのウェブサイトは、クライアントに対してサービスを提供するた…
View ArticleNode.jsを学ぶ #1
Node.jsに関する要点まとめ Node.jsとは? JavaScriptのサーバーサイド環境: 通常、JavaScriptはフロントエンド(HTML、CSSと組み合わせて動的なWebページを作る…
View ArticleNode.jsを学ぶ #2
学習の内容説明 ポケモンデータの詳細情報を非同期処理で取得し、表示する部分です。以下のように概要をまとめます ローディング表示の追加 ポケモンデータを取得する際に、非同期処理が完了するまで「ロード中…
View ArticleOpenAI Realtime APIを動かしてみた
作成日:2024年10月20日(日) 1.はじめに 私たちがこれまでに生成AIで使用してきた自然言語処理(NLP:Neuro Linguistic Programming)はChatGPTなどのチ…
View Article